Highgate is a leading real estate investment and hospitality management company that stands as an innovator in the hospitality industry. Recognized as a dominant player in key U.S. gateway markets such as New York, Boston, Miami, San Francisco, and Honolulu, Highgate boasts a rapidly expanding presence in international locations including Europe, Latin America, and the Caribbean. The company manages a diverse and prestigious portfolio of global properties with an aggregate asset value exceeding $20 billion, generating over $5 billion in cumulative annual revenues.
